Patent number: 11923611Abstract: A dual-frequency and dual-polarization antenna for simultaneously transmitting and receiving dual-frequency 5G signals comprises: a first substrate; a first polarization antenna comprising a first radiation portion disposed on a first surface of the first substrate and a second radiation portion disposed on a second surface of the first substrate; a second polarization antenna comprising a third radiation portion disposed on the first surface of the first substrate and a fourth radiation portion disposed on the second surface of the first substrate; a second substrate located in a side of the second surface of the first substrate, a surface of the second substrate close to the first substrate is a copper-clad surface; and layout directions of the first polarization antenna and the second polarization antenna are orthogonal to each other in the first substrate. An electronic device comprising the dual-frequency and dual-polarization antenna is also provided.Type: GrantFiled: April 26, 2021Date of Patent: March 5, 2024Assignee: HONG FU JIN PRECISION INDUSTRY (WuHan) CO., LTD.Inventor: Hsin-Nan Hu

Patent number: 8731624Abstract: An electronic device for accessing wireless network includes a radio frequency (RF) module, a power supply management unit, a CPU and a data transmission interface. The RF module receives electromagnetic wave signal from networks and transmits electromagnetic wave signals to the networks. The data transmission interface transmits the electromagnetic wave signals from the RF module to the CPU, and transmits data and commands between the RF module and the CPU. When the electronic device does not communicate with a remote server on the networks during a predetermined time period, the CPU suspends the data transmission interface. A related method of saving resource is also provided.Type: GrantFiled: April 11, 2011Date of Patent: May 20, 2014Assignees: Hong Fu Jin Precision Industry (ShenZhen) Co., Ltd., Hon Hai Precision Industry Co., Ltd.Inventors: Dong-Sheng Li, Han-Che Wang, Hsin-Nan Hu, Jun-Xin Chai

Publication number: 20130271387Abstract: A wireless communicating electronic device includes a wireless communication unit, a shell receiving the wireless communicating unit therein, a touch sensing unit, and a processing unit. The touch sensing unit includes an antenna, a regulating circuit, and an analog-digital (AD) converting module. A given portion spatially corresponding to the antenna defined on the shell. The antenna generates an alternating current (AC) signal in response to a finger touch on the given portion. The regulating circuit regulates the AC signal. The AD converting module converts the AC signal into a digital signal. The processing unit executes an instruction in response to the digital signal.Type: ApplicationFiled: July 13, 2012Publication date: October 17, 2013Applicants: HON HAI PRECISION INDUSTRY CO., LTD., HONG FU JIN PRECISION INDUSTRY (ShenZhen) CO., LTD.Inventors: JUN-XIN CHAI, HSIN-NAN HU

Publication number: 20100063687Abstract: This present disclosure provides a global positioning system (GPS) device, and a method of safe driving. The GPS device includes a storage unit, the storage unit configured to store map data and speed limit information of each speed limit section. Each speed limit information includes a speed limit start position, a speed limit end position, and a first predetermined speed value, the method includes steps of: receiving GPS satellite navigation signals in real time; detecting current location of a vehicle and determine whether the vehicle is in a speed limit section; detecting current speed value of the vehicle when the vehicle is in a speed limit section; generating and sending a control signal to control a safety protection unit to perform a safety protection operation, when the current speed value is greater than the first predetermined speed value in the speed limit section.Type: ApplicationFiled: June 12, 2009Publication date: March 11, 2010Applicants: HONG FU JIN PRECISION INDUSTRY (ShenZhen) CO., LTD, HON HAI PRECISION INDUSTRY CO., LTD.Inventors: HSIN-NAN HU, QING-LONG MA, KUAN-HONG HSIEH, XIAO-GUANG LI
